package android.tools.device.flicker.legacy
import android.tools.common.NavBar
import android.tools.common.Rotation
import android.tools.common.ScenarioBuilder
/**
* Factory for creating JUnit4 compatible tests based on the flicker DSL
*
* This class recreates behavior from JUnit5 TestFactory that is not available on JUnit4
*/
object FlickerTestFactory {
/**
* Gets a list of test configurations.
*
* Each configuration has only a start orientation.
*/
@JvmOverloads
@JvmStatic
fun nonRotationTests(
supportedRotations: List<Rotation> = listOf(Rotation.ROTATION_0, Rotation.ROTATION_90),
supportedNavigationModes: List<NavBar> = listOf(NavBar.MODE_3BUTTON, NavBar.MODE_GESTURAL),
extraArgs: Map<String, Any> = emptyMap()
): List<FlickerTest> {
return supportedNavigationModes.flatMap { navBarMode ->
supportedRotations.map { rotation ->
createFlickerTest(navBarMode, rotation, rotation, extraArgs)
}
}
}
/**
* Gets a list of test configurations.
*
* Each configuration has a start and end orientation.
*/
@JvmOverloads
@JvmStatic
fun rotationTests(
supportedRotations: List<Rotation> = listOf(Rotation.ROTATION_0, Rotation.ROTATION_90),
supportedNavigationModes: List<NavBar> = listOf(NavBar.MODE_3BUTTON, NavBar.MODE_GESTURAL),
extraArgs: Map<String, Any> = emptyMap()
): List<FlickerTest> {
return supportedNavigationModes.flatMap { navBarMode ->
supportedRotations
.flatMap { start -> supportedRotations.map { end -> start to end } }
.filter { (start, end) -> start != end }
.map { (start, end) -> createFlickerTest(navBarMode, start, end, extraArgs) }
}
}
private fun createFlickerTest(
navBarMode: NavBar,
startRotation: Rotation,
endRotation: Rotation,
extraArgs: Map<String, Any>
) =
FlickerTest(
ScenarioBuilder()
.withStartRotation(startRotation)
.withEndRotation(endRotation)
.withNavBarMode(navBarMode)
.withExtraConfigs(extraArgs)
)
}
